Description
Concise, easy to use, and thoroughly updated to cover Mac OS X 10.2, this new edition of the Mac OS X Pocket Guide introduces you to the fundamental concepts of Mac OS X. It also features a handy "Mac OS X Survival Guide," that shows Mac users what's changed from Mac OS 9, and helps Windows and Unix converts get acclimated to their new OS.

    About the Author
    1. Chuck Toporek

      Chuck Toporek cut his teeth on a Mac II system when he got his first job in publishing in 1988, and has been using them ever since. Chuck is a senior editor in charge of the Mac OS X/Apple Developer Connection (ADC) series for O'Reilly & Associates, Inc. He is also the author/editor of the Mac OS X Panther Pocket Guide, co-author of Mac OS X in a Nutshell, and author of the upcoming title, Inside .Mac.
